Recognizing Life Insurance Policy: Types and Benefits for Seniors



As individuals age, understanding life insurance ends up being significantly crucial for economic safety and security and comfort. For elders, life insurance policy offers different objectives, consisting of covering funeral service expenses, clearing up impressive financial obligations, and providing financial backing for loved ones. The primary sorts of life insurance available to senior citizens are whole life insurance and term life insurance policy. Entire life insurance policy supplies long-lasting coverage and a cash value component, making it a stable option for those seeking lasting advantages. On the other hand, term life insurance policy gives coverage for a specific duration, frequently at lower premiums, suitable for those with short-term financial responsibilities. In addition, final cost insurance coverage is customized especially for senior citizens, concentrating on covering end-of-life prices. Each type presents unique advantages depending on individual scenarios, making certain that seniors can choose a plan that aligns with their monetary goals and household demands while preserving a complacency throughout their later years.

Medicare Insurance Coverage Basics



Comprehending Medicare insurance coverage is basic for people entering their senior years, specifically since it acts as a main source of health and wellness insurance for those aged 65 and older - Medicare Insurance Broker. Medicare includes various components: Part A covers medical facility insurance, while Part B addresses outpatient clinical services. Furthermore, Component C, referred to as Medicare Benefit, combines both A and B protection, often consisting of fringe benefits. Component D uses prescription medicine coverage, which is crucial for handling health care prices. Registration generally begins 3 months prior to an individual turns 65, allowing for timely access to needed medical solutions. It is essential for elders to acquaint themselves with these parts to make informed decisions concerning their healthcare alternatives and guarantee adequate coverage throughout their retirement years


Supplemental Insurance Policy Choices



As individuals browse their medical care alternatives in retired life, supplementary insurance policy can play a crucial role in filling the gaps left by Medicare. Numerous seniors consider Medigap policies, which are made to cover out-of-pocket prices such as copayments, coinsurance, and deductibles. These plans provide numerous plans with various degrees of protection, enabling versatility based upon individual demands. Furthermore, some seniors choose Medicare Benefit intends, which supply an option to typical Medicare, usually consisting of extra benefits like dental and vision care. Prescription drug insurance coverage is another critical part, motivating lots of to discover Medicare Component D strategies. Inevitably, choosing the best supplemental insurance can substantially improve healthcare safety and decrease financial burdens for senior citizens.

Enrollment Periods Summary



When should senior citizens think about enrolling in Medicare? Senior citizens commonly become eligible for Medicare at age 65, with the First Enrollment Duration starting three months before their birthday month and finishing three months after. It is crucial for seniors to enlist during this time around to moved here stay clear of penalties. Furthermore, there are Unique Enrollment Periods for those who experience certifying life occasions, such as shedding employer-sponsored protection. The Annual Enrollment Period happens from October 15 to December 7, enabling seniors to make adjustments to their strategies. Understanding these enrollment durations assurances seniors receive the essential coverage while preventing unnecessary costs. Elders must thoroughly examine their wellness treatment requirements and strategy accordingly to maximize their take advantage of Medicare.
